Compare all specifications:
2008 Chevrolet Malibu | 2009 BMW 630 | |
Make | Chevrolet | BMW |
Model | Malibu | 630 |
Year Released | 2008 | 2009 |
Body Type | Sedan |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2401 cc | 2996 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 170 HP | 268 HP |
Engine RPM | 6400 RPM | 6700 RPM |
Torque | 217 Nm | 320 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4500 RPM | 2750 RPM |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4880 mm | 4830 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1790 mm | 1860 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1460 mm | 1380 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2860 mm | 2790 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 9.4 L/100km | 7.9 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 61 L | 70 L |
